Stuffed Scallop Shells

Origin: Florence, Italy

Source: Pellegrino Artusi, 1891

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Make a balsamella with the milk, butter, and flour; off the heat add Parmesan, then the egg yolks and chopped boiled fish, with salt and pepper.
  2. Grease the scallop shells with cold butter and fill with the mixture.
  3. Brown lightly in a Dutch oven and serve (boiled chicken may replace the fish).
